What are the responsibilities and job description for the RN Care Manager - Inpatient position at Northshore Home Health Care?
The RN Hospital Care Manager I delivers comprehensive care management services to patients in both inpatient and outpatient settings.
Responsibilities include conducting assessments, developing and adjusting patient-centered care plans, providing education and advocacy, and supporting self-management through motivational interviewing.
They coll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ure high-quality, efficient care, lead process improvement initiatives, and analyze data to meet regulatory standards.
Qualifications include a current RN license, a BSN (or obtaining one within four years), and clinical experience in a hospital setting with disease management knowledge.
Skills required encompass assessment, care planning, communication, critical thinking, and time management.
Physical requirements involve visual acuity, manual dexterity, mental stamina, and, if applicable, driving capabilities.
This role offers a flexible schedule, a competitive hourly rate, and benefits focused on wellness and professional growth.
